There is no end to the surprises in FK Budućnost - when it seemed that everything had already been seen, and there was so much, a new plot followed, this time in the "family circle".
The information that the Board of Directors has dismissed the executive director was published by all Montenegrin media, but the dismissal has not yet been made official, because it has not been signed by the President of the Board of Directors.
And that detail actually reveals a lot. The president was not even present at the session of the body he chairs.
Illogical events and phenomena are the most difficult to explain, including this one, because there is no common sense explanation why the president does not attend a meeting where important decisions are made for the functioning of a club or organization in general, unless he has authorized members to decide on his behalf.
The fact that the club president and the director were together at the Buducnost match in Nikšić on Sunday, and that his signature is not (yet) there, shows that the president did not exactly support the director's dismissal.
In the whole story, however, the names are the least important. Nor is it crucial how the executive director worked.
The system on which the largest and most trophy-winning Montenegrin club currently rests is important.
In other words, this is not about any system, but about anarchy, or, what seems more realistic - about games in another fight for supremacy in the club, which is also the largest sports "consumer" of the city budget. In recent months, Buducnost has received, or will receive in the coming period, between two and three million euros.
It is not clear why the executive director is targeted, given that his powers should not be too extensive, but mainly stem from decisions of the Board of Directors, which appointed him.
The director, in the end, and looking only from a sporting aspect, does not choose the sports director, the coach, or the players, nor does he determine their salaries, but practically implements the decisions of the Board of Directors in accordance with the budget available to the club.
The fact that the club's (read - part of the city's) budget is mostly spent on salaries (over 250 thousand euros per month) is not the director's decision, but rather the decision of the board members. Nor was it his decision to bring in 11 new players in January...
At the end of January, the club president, commenting on the conflict with the fans, stated in a press release that this is the moment "when the Management stabilizes, consolidates and cleans the club from bad practices and those middlemen who have been parasitizing and profiting from FK Buducnost for years, when reinforcements were brought in during the winter transfer window for respect, when the Management brought in the best regional sports experts and provided all the conditions to bring FK Buducnost back and onto a healthy path, when the greatest support has been provided by the Capital City...".
And suddenly - the members of the Board of Directors (Mileta Šćepanović, Feđa Smatlik, Ninoslav Kaliđerović, Nikola Marković) find "a series of shortcomings" in the work of the director alone, and one of them is, allegedly, (good, i.e. normal) communication with the Football Association of Montenegro and the relevant committees and bodies.
Perhaps that is actually his greatest sin.
If so, then the background to the new upheaval is clear as day (“attack” on FSCG), and if not - it is an elementary obligation of the Board members to explain the reasons why his departure is being requested.
Not because of the fans and the football public, because, unfortunately, few people are interested in Buducnost as a sports team anymore, but because of two, three, four or five million euros of city money.
